Audio Database

SC-903V
Commentary

The SC 907 / SC 905 technology has been put into this speaker system, which is compatible with AV while seeking excellent reproduction capability.

In order to make it an anti-magnetic type, a canceling sub-magnet and an anti-magnetic cap effectively block leakage magnetic flux and improve magnetic flux density.

A 22 cm cone woofer with a PCM diaphragm is installed in the low range.
This diaphragm is based on polypropylene, which has properties comparable to those of paper, and is a special mixture of carbon graphite and mica. It is 2.5 times more rigid than conventional woofer diaphragms and 9 times more rigid than paper cone diaphragms.

A 4.3 cm hard dome type skoker is mounted in the middle area.
Both sides of the diaphragm are specially treated hard light alloy, and linearity is greatly improved by direct radiation structure and push-pull double suspension.

A 1.6 cm hard dome type tweeter with α -Boron diaphragm is mounted in the high range.
This diaphragm is composed of an aluminum substrate and a filler (boron compound and alumina), and achieves approximately three times the rigidity of titanium.

The network is separated for low, middle and high frequencies to reduce distortion caused by interference between circuits.

The enclosure uses a softwood hard particle board.

Model Rating
Method 3-way, 3-speaker, bass reflex system, bookshelf type, magnetic protection design
Units Used For low band : 22 cm cone type
For Middle Area : 4.3 cm Dome Type
For high-pass : 1.6 cm dome type
Frequency characteristic 35 Hz to 65 kHz
Impedance 6 Ω
Maximum allowable input 110W (program source)
Mean output sound pressure 92dB/W/m
Crossover frequency 1500 Hz, 8000 Hz
External dimensions Width 297x Height 525x Depth 252 mm
Weight 12.0kg
